As the boy finished singing the last note of 'The City Is Ours', Logan, to celebrate, threw his hands up in the air, hitting Carlos in the face and knocking him down.

Not bothered by the daily occurrence, Kendall leaned into the mic. "Gustavo, the song is great."

"Of course it's great, I wrote it. But the band isn't great!" He walked into the room with Kelly and Alex behind him. "What's missing is the secret rock and roll ingredient."

"Hair mousse."

"Chocolate mousse."

"Spandex? Please don't say spandex."

"The bad boy." Gustavo wrapped his arm around Logan. "The ill-tempered rebel with a flair for synchronized dance. One of you boys has to be it." As he walked down the line of boys, he stopped as he hovered over Kendall's shoulder. "I say it's Kendall." As the boy made a face as Kelly gave him finger guns.

AH, AH, AH-AH, OH

"Gustavo, why do we need a bad boy?"

Kelly pulled up her phone, showing the boys a voicemail from Griffin. "Gustavo, it's Griffin. The band needs a bad boy. Bye"

"He's driving me crazy!" He screamed the last word. "But he's right, because the bad boy is a rock and roll tradition." Gustavo starts to walk into the hallway, everyone following him as he shows the posters. "Notice the back turned to the rest of the band. Bad boy. Notice the back turned, the dark clothing, and the scowl. Bad boy."

"But there can only be one bad boy per group." Kelly popped up, pulling a sheet to show another poster. "As learned from the bad boys experiment of '95."

"Didn't sell a single CD."

"Good." Alex mumbled. "I heard some of their music and it should not see the light of day." He shivered, almost liked it pained him to remember the horrendous music.

Ignoring Alex's comment, Kendall spoke. "But we're best friends. We never turn our back on eachother." The rest of the band agreed with him. Knowing that nothing would break their friendship.

Gustavo rolled his eyes. "Then let me let you in on another rock and roll secret. The bad boy is also the most popular member of the band, makes the most money, and dates the hottest models."

James, Carlos, and Logan blinked. Once, twice, thrice.

"I can be bad!"

"I am so bad!"

"Look at my back, look at my back!"

Kendall and Alex give each other a side eye, already knowing that this was going to be a disaster.

—-------

After that whole debacle, Gustavo sent the band back to the palm woods for lunch on the promise that they would be back in two hours. Also knowing that the boys would want to fight one another for the band boy role (besides Kendall), Gustavo, Kelly, and Alex had set up a table at the end of the hallway.

"You really think having a bad boy is a good idea?" Kelly asked as she pulled out her chair.

Gustavo waved her off. "Quiet. Here they come."

As Alex saw the boys (with the exception of Kendall) stumbled down the hallway with clothes at least two sizes too big, he would have smacked his head on the table if Kelly didn't place a pillow right before it could make contact. The pop artist's head then popped up at the sound of a board breaking only to see Carlos falling over with the wooden board still in his hands.

As they blinked at the boy who knocked himself out cold, Gustavo's voice caused them to look back at the table. "Next!"

James, trying his best, began spitting bars that made everyone cringe. "B to the A to the D, that's me! A bad boy-ee!"
